Transaction e120234784043f942850398dee99203978cb16eed06ef77b19076dc8b8e38021
1 Input
1 Output
-
e120234784043f942850398dee99203978cb16eed06ef77b19076dc8b8e38021:0
- value
- 1873014
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cda9a8a1599369c03243cdac1c0336fc30aff19611e2c08867cb98642290213e
- address
- bc1pek563g2ejd5uqvjrekkpcqeklsc2luvkz83vpzr8ewvxgg5syylq20g6ur